Mitch Hyatt: Back in action
Hyatt (knee) was seen trying out for the Giants on Thursday, Aaron Wilson of ProFootballNetwork.com reports.
Hyatt suffered a knee injury that has forced him to miss the past two seasons with the Cowboys. Now that he's back to full health, the offensive tackle will fight for a roster spot in an attempt to earn a depth role in New York for the upcoming 2022-23 campaign.

Cowboys' Mitch Hyatt: Lands on IR
Hyatt (knee) was moved from the preseason PUP list to IR on Tuesday, NFL reporter Aaron Wilson reports.
Hyatt was carted off the field last August with a knee injury and missed the entire 2020 campaign. Now, it appears that his status for 2021 may be in jeopardy as well.

Cowboys' Mitch Hyatt: Lands on PUP list
Hyatt (knee) was placed on the preseason PUP list Thursday, Todd Archer of ESPN.com reports.
Hyatt was carted off the field last August due to a knee injury, and he was forced to miss the entire 2020 campaign. It's not yet clear when he could return to the field in 2021.

Mitch Hyatt: Let go by Dallas
Hyatt (knee) was waived/injured by the Cowboys on Wednesday.
Hyatt had to be carted off the field Thursday, and, as evidenced by this news, the injury appears to be serious. Hyatt was only expected to supply a depth role in 2020 if he was to make the roster, and he'll revert to injured reserve if he goes unclaimed off waivers.

Cowboys' Mitch Hyatt: Carted off practice field
Hyatt was carted off Thursday's practice field due to an apparent knee or leg injury, David Helman & Rob Phillips of the Cowboys' official site reports.
Hyatt could challenge for a depth role along Dallas' offensive line if healthy, but he'll first need to determine the severity of his injury. Per Michael Gehlken of The Dallas Morning News, initial evaluations indicate that Hyatt could be in line to miss significant time.
